#594304 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#594304 is composed of 34.9% red, 26.3% green and 1.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 24.7% magenta, 95.5% yellow and 65.1% black. It has a hue angle of 44.5 degrees, a saturation of 91.4% and a lightness of 18.2%. #594304 color hex could be obtained by blending #b28608 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#663300.

● #594304 color description : Very dark orange [Brown tone].
#594304 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#594304 has RGB values of R:89, G:67, B:4 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.25, Y:0.96, K:0.65. Its decimal value is 5849860.

Shades and Tints of #594304
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0e0a01 is the darkest color, while #fffefa is the lightest one.

Tones of #594304
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#32302b is the less saturated color, while #5d4500 is the most saturated one.
